基于SpringBoot+Vue的在线点餐系统

技术栈:
后台框架:SpringBoot、MyBatis
前端技术:VUE
开发工具:IDEA
数据库:MySQL、Navicat

客户端地址:http://localhost:8888/front/index.html              账号/密码:attr/123456
管理端地址:http://localhost:8888/end/page/login.html       账号/密码:admin/123456

创新点:
创新点一:首页热卖菜品销量排序:本系统创新地在客户端首页实时展示热卖菜品,并依据菜品销量进行动态排序。这一设计不仅能迅速吸引顾客的注意力,提升用户点餐体验,还能帮助餐厅精准把握市场需求,优化菜品供应,提升整体经营效益。

创新点二:在线交流与餐饮评价功能:本系统引入了在线交流与餐饮评价功能,顾客可实时与餐厅互动,分享用餐体验,提供宝贵意见。这不仅增强了顾客参与感与归属感,也为餐厅提供了改进服务的方向,有助于提升顾客满意度和忠诚度,构建良好的品牌形象。

需求分析:

1、系统管理员应实现的功能如下:
(1)登录:从系统安全性考虑,系统内所有用户都需要凭个人账户密码登录系统进行系统操作。
(2)用户管理:系统管理员需要对用户信息进行管理,包括对用户信息进行新增、删除、修改或查询等操作;
(3)菜品分类管理:系统管理员需要对菜品分类信息进行管理,包括对菜品分类信息进行新增、删除、修改或查询等操作;
(4)菜品管理:系统管理员需要对菜品信息进行管理,包括对菜品信息进行新增、删除、修改或查询等操作;
(5)订单管理:系统管理员需要对订单信息进行管理,包括对订单信息进行状态变更或删除操作;
(6)餐饮评价管理:系统管理员需要对餐饮评价信息进行管理,包括查询评论信息、删除恶意评论等;
(7)在线交流管理:系统管理员需要对交流信息进行管理,包括对交流信息进行新增、删除、修改或查询操作等;
(8)个人信息修改:系统管理员可修改个人信息如手机号、邮箱、身份证等;
(9)修改密码:系统管理员可在系统内修改个人登录密码。
2、系统用户应实现的功能如下:
(1)注册:系统游客需注册成为系统用户才能进行在线点餐、在线交流等操作;
(2)登录:系统用户可凭注册账号与密码登录系统;
(3)菜品浏览:系统用户可查看系统内发布的所有菜品详细信息;
(4)加入购物车:系统用户可选择将想吃的菜品加入购物车中;
(5)下单:系统用户可在我的购物车中选择菜品进行下单操作;
(6)我的订单:系统用户可查看个人所有的订单信息,并可对订单付款、确认或删除等操作来更新订单状态;
(7)餐饮评价:系统用户可对已下单的菜品进行评价;
(8)在校交流:系统用户可在系统内进行在线交流,包括发布留言或回复其他人的留言等;
(9)个人信息:系统用户可修改个人注册的个人信息

需要源码或视频演示可私信
 

  • 5
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值